Our client is a respected Irish organisation with a strong presence across Ireland. As the business continues to grow they are seeking to hire an Accounts Receivable Team Lead.

This role offers an excellent opportunity for someone ready to step into a leadership position while benefiting from a hybrid working model and flexible working hours.

Responsibilities:

- Lead and manage a small Accounts Receivable team, including workload distribution, team meetings, and ongoing support.
- Evaluate and authorize credit applications, oversee customer accounts, and implement measures to recover overdue payments.
- Perform analysis of aged debtor balances, uphold AR policies, and drive process enhancements.
- Supervise daily bank reconciliations, ensuring all transactions are reviewed and verified.
- Act as the primary contact for internal departments and external partners, preparing reports and presenting to senior leadership.
- Handle escalated payment issues or complex customer queries.
- Act as a key liaison with both internal stakeholders and external partners, preparing and delivering reports to senior management.
- Deliver training, mentorship, and performance feedback to team members to ensure skill development and high performance.

Requirements:

- In-depth knowledge of AR processes, credit control, and best practices in receivables management.
- Proficient in Microsoft Excel and other financial systems.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ills for cross-functional collaboration.
- Exceptional attention to detail and a high degree of accuracy in financial transactions.
- Solid foundation in general accounting principles and accounts procedures.
